If a nucleus ᴢXᴬ emits 9α and 5β-particles, then the ratio of total protons and neutrons in the final nucleus is
Options
(a) (Z-13)/(A-36)
(b) (Z-13)/(A-Z-13)
(c) (Z-18)/(A-36)
(d) (Z-13)/(A-Z-23)
Correct Answer:
(Z-13)/(A-Z-23)
